Output 61b42ec69594c22fab1e91a03b58b052f315575122c2eacc595dd06314978f8f:0

value
2241755
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a405dcd406e36ffa84f36376dedf12a0bc32ca5 OP_EQUAL
address
3HDDuQqG35S9s4YtiGZ5spNNJ594LpgSke
transaction
61b42ec69594c22fab1e91a03b58b052f315575122c2eacc595dd06314978f8f
spent
true